A DAY IN THE LIFE
You’ll be joining the strong L’Oréal UKI Supply Planning team, in the key role of Supply Planner.
Your role is anything but ordinary and every day can be different. The Supply Planner role sits at the heart of L'Oréal, with multiple touch points across a wide variety of functions and stakeholders (Marketing, Commercial, Demand Planning, Customer Supply Chain, local and international distribution centres, and international supply chain teams) and would see you responsible for the supply of our iconic brands. Your day could begin with managing inventory levels and maintaining & updating the planning system. If any upcoming out of stocks have been identified work closely with the Demand Planner and Customer Supply Chain teams to understand the cause. After analysing the potential business impact, you would then be on call with the S&OP team to try and understand how soon we can next get stock; putting in action plans to get it to the UK as soon as possible and aligning the stakeholders needed to do so. The afternoon may see you working on stock reporting identifying risks of excess stock and looking at plans to use and reuse with our L’Oréal for the Future commitments. It could also see you working on developing a new report to simplify processes or implement new ones for the team or the division. Just before the end of your day you might need to align with the DC on incoming inbounds providing priorities for next day to ensure all goes smoothly. The Supply Planner role it's a fast-paced, challenging, and rewarding role that sits at the heart of L'Oréal's commitment to beauty and customer satisfaction.
